Output 8a874d56f9acaabcf3e58c1b18459c744d5ae152a1222201584cf43c45c85f5f:25

value
37576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5cb6a0bdc9f04b8250f84a143e884b037db50ff OP_EQUAL
address
3MBTXsbBjyqKChDLot2YTQN2f14dYoE1Gq
transaction
8a874d56f9acaabcf3e58c1b18459c744d5ae152a1222201584cf43c45c85f5f
spent
true